when you have AK224, I usually keep the A22, raise pre draw, bet big after the draw representing a set. works mircles in the long run.

also, when I have a set, let say 999A5, I keep the 333A and once again raise pre draw, and bet big after the draw representing 2 pair, or a missed draw, maybe you get called by a pair, or 2 pair or smaller set.

I like to keep at leat 3 cards no matter what. That way you opponet never knows what you have . that way you can bluff, get people to call your trips, and protect a big single pair. I think its alot easier to bluff in this game then HE.
